360i Turns Agency Toy Hoarding Into Gift Giving

Share your toys via Twitter or Instagram to make a real-life donation

If a child were to enter nearly any agency, start-up, tech or media company, they’d find a treasure trove of toys – desk ornaments, ping pong tables, pin ball machines, PlayStations, Nerf guns, action figures and more – that working adults are often taking for granted. 

That’s why this holiday season, 360i is on a mission to get these toys into the hands of those who deserve them most – children and adolescents – by inviting the industry to join a first-of-its-kind socially-fuelled #AgencyToyDrive that challenges us to give as many toys as possible to the deserving children at Harlem’s Children Zone, Year Up and the Ann & Robert H. Lurie Children’s Hospital of Chicago.  The best part?  People can give back without giving away anything at all. 

Participation is simple – Beginning December 15, anyone can share their toys and tokens via Twitter and Instagram using the hashtag #AgencyToyDrive, and 360i will transform these submissions into real-life toy donations.  We’ll create a collective digital toy bin at AgencyToyDrive.com that will inspire an abundance of holiday gifts for deserving children throughout the country, and our elves will update the site to confirm when donations have been fulfilled.
